SB 155 Indiana Senate · 2023 Regular Session

Air pollution control.

Summary
Provides that a federal regulation that classifies or amends a designation of attainment, nonattainment, or unclassifiable for any area in Indiana under the federal Clean Air Act is effective and enforceable in Indiana on the effective date of the federal regulation. Requires the environmental rules board (board) to adopt rules, including emergency rules, to raise two Title V operating permit program fees, increasing: (1) the annual fee for a Part 70 permit to $6,100; and (2) the annual fee for a federally enforceable state operating permit (FESOP) to $6,100; for five years, beginning with the fees first due and collectable after December 31, 2023. Requires the board, not more than 45 days after the effective date of the SECTION requiring the adoption of the rules, to provide notice in the Indiana Register of the first public comment period required before the adoption of the permanent rules raising the two fees. Prohibits the board from beginning to adopt the emergency rules to raise the two fees until the notice of the first comment period concerning the permanent rules to raise the two fees is published.
